COLOGNE, (Germany) (Reuters) What happens to artworks which are too badly damaged to be restored once the Insurer has paid out the claim? Up to 300 of them – scratched, torn or punctured works by well-known artists including Gerhard Richter, Christo and Giorgio de Chirico – are stored in an AXA warehouse near the western […]
